Final 9 - Tie at 4th.

Scenario: 2 Day 54 Hole tournament with a final 9 for top 4 in division.
Dilemma: There are 3 players tied for 4th place after the 54 regulation holes.

How will you handle this? Playoff? Two cards playing the final?

Your answer is in sections 1.8 and 1.9 of the Competition Manual. Sudden death for the slot if alternative procedure (like all tied players advancing) wasn't announced in advance.

what i do at my event is to allow both players in if it is a 2 player tie and have a playoff to get in if more than 2 are tied. i don't want more than 5 in the final. (and it is in print in advance)
